I'm playing a ranger in my current campaign and we just got to level 6 last night. I took a level in cleric but was unable to prepare spells above level 1 under my cleric spells on my character sheet. The wording of cleric spell casting says:
"You prepare the list of cleric spells that are available for you to cast, choosing from the cleric spell list. When you do so, choose a number of cleric spells equal to your Wisdom modifier + your cleric level (minimum of one spell). The spells must be of a level for which you have spell slots."
My understanding is that since I have level 2 spell slots, I should be able to prepare things like prayer of healing or lesser restoration under my 4 cleric spells I can prepare from 1 level in cleric and a +3 wisdom modifier.
Can anyone explain if I'm wrong or if there is something off with the character sheet coding? Thanks
What SwiftSign said. This is the multiclassing rules for spellcasting and is working as intended.
Spells Known and Prepared. You determine what spells you know and can prepare for each class individually, as if you were a single-classed member of that class. If you are a ranger 4/wizard 3, for example, you know three 1st-level ranger spells based on your levels in the ranger class. As 3rd-level wizard, you know three wizard cantrips, and your spellbook contains ten wizard spells, two of which (the two you gained when you reached 3rd level as a wizard) can be 2nd-level spells. If your Intelligence is 16, you can prepare six wizard spells from your spellbook.
